Characterization
A substance is characterized through burn rate vs pressure chart and burn rate vs temperature chart.
- Greater than 1,138 feet per second (347 m/s): "detonation"
- A few meters per second: "deflagration"
- A few centimeters per second: "burn" or "smolder"
- 0.01 mm/s to 100 mm/s: "decomposing rapidly" to characterize it.
However, there is difference in opinion in differentiating the three in absence of firm numbers at given pressure or temperature.
